Charge in 2014 murder

UPDATE: 2:10 p.m.

Kelowna RCMP are commenting on the murder charge laid in a nearly three-year-old case.

Steven Randy Pirko has been charged with second-degree murder in the death Chris Ausman, who was found in a pool of blood in Rutland on Jan. 25, 2014.

"From the early onset of this investigation, there were key factors to suggest that Christopher’s death was suspicious in nature, as such the Kelowna RCMP Serious Crime Unit (SCU) assumed conduct of the investigation into his death," said police in a statement.

"On Friday, Nov. 18, 2016, serious crime investigators co-ordinated and effected the arrest of a suspect believed to be connected with the alleged homicide, of Christopher Ausman."

Police said the investigation is ongoing, and no further information will be provided. 


ORIGINAL: 1:50 p.m.

A murder charge has been laid in a nearly three-year-old Kelowna murder case.

Steven Randy Pirko has been charged with murder in the death Chris Ausman, who was found in a pool of blood in Rutland on Jan. 25, 2014.

Pirko is scheduled to make an appearance in Kelowna court Wednesday to face the charge.

He was found on the sidewalk on the 100 block of Highway 33.

While police took several months to confirm the death was a homicide, family and friends quickly told the media he was murdered.

The 32-year-old Kelowna victim was a young father.

Pirko has a criminal history stretching back years.
